FLM5964-12F-001 is C-Band Internally Matched FET manufactured by SUMITOMO.
FEATURES
- High Output Power: P1d B=41.5d Bm(Typ.)
- High Gain: G1d B=9.0d B(Typ.)
- High PAE: hadd=37%(Typ.)
- Broad Band: 5.85 to 6.75GHz
- Impedance Matched Zin/Zout = 50ohm
- Hermetically Sealed Package DESCRIPTION
The FLM5964-12F/001 is a power Ga As FET that is internally matched for standard munication bands to provide optimum power and gain in a 50ohm system.
